Dental implants for individuals with gum disease present a singular set of challenges and concerns. Gum disease, also called periodontal disease, impacts the supporting buildings of the teeth, together with the gums and the bone. The initial step for anyone with gum disease is to seek skilled treatment to address the underlying condition. This often entails thorough cleanings often identified as scaling and root planing, which purpose to remove plaque and tartar buildup that harbor micro organism. In some circumstances, sufferers might require extra treatments such as antibiotics and even surgery to restore gum health. Only after the gums have adequately healed and regained stability ought to one contemplate transferring forward with implant placement.

Once the gum disease is managed, understanding the extent of the bone loss is important. Periodontal disease can result in the recession of the bone that supports the teeth, making the jaw less capable of accommodate dental implants. A complete evaluation, together with imaging studies similar to X-rays or 3D scans, is essential in figuring out how a lot bone is present and whether grafting procedures could additionally be essential.


Bone grafting is a typical process for these with insufficient bone volume. During this process, bone materials is added to enhance the prevailing bone structure. This could be created from various sources, including artificial materials or the affected person's personal bone harvested from another web site. Bone grafting not only creates a stable base for implants but in addition encourages new bone development within the space.

After the bone grafting process, it may be very important give ample time for healing. This healing time can range depending on the individual’s health and the complexity of the therapy. In some circumstances, it would take a number of months before proceeding with dental implants. Patience throughout this stage is vital as dashing the process can compromise general results and long-term success.


Once sufficient bone has fashioned, the dental implant process can start. The implant, a titanium post, is surgically positioned into the jawbone. This submit acts like a root for a replacement tooth, and over time, a process known as osseointegration happens. Osseointegration is crucial for the soundness of the implant and involves the bone growing across the implant, firmly securing it in place.


Following implant placement, the therapeutic process continues. During this era, the gentle tissues should heal around the implant with out infection or problems. Regular follow-ups with a dental professional are important to observe therapeutic and handle any issues which will arise.


For people with a history of gum disease, meticulous oral hygiene is essential both before and after implant placement. Maintaining clean gums and teeth helps prevent re-infection and ensures the long-term success of the implants. This consists of common dental check-ups, every day brushing, flossing, and sometimes using antimicrobial rinses as recommended by a dentist.

Factors like smoking and sure medical conditions can adversely affect the success of implants for these with gum disease. Smoking, as an example, can hinder blood flow and therapeutic, whereas conditions like diabetes can slow down recovery and enhance the chance for problems. Addressing way of life components is essential to maximize the prospect of profitable outcomes.
